Bodegas La Horra - Corimbo I 2009/10 6x 75cl Bottles

Bodegas La Horra is the new project in Ribera del Duero. 20 years old year vines of Tempranillo are used to produce Corimbo I. The Alcoholic fermentation takes place in wooden vats and stainless steel tanks whereas the malolactic fermentation occurs in wooden vats and barrels. The ageing will last about 12 months in barrels made of 80% French oak and 20% American oak. A very intense, deep, elegant, heady nose with well integrated oak. A lot of ripe black fruit. Mineral hints, sweet spice, black chocolate combined with ripe fruit. A full, rich palate. Ripe, fresh black fruit, mineral, with the hint of chocolate. Retronasal powerful with refreshing balsamic hints from the aromatic plants in the pine forest. Tannins of great quality are present. Excellent finish of ripe fruit very
black, cocoa and refreshing balsamic hints. Serve at room temperature accompanied by fine rich dishes such as roasted venison or grilled beef.
